Hats and gloves were very much in evidence tonight - our first really cold Goodgym night of the winter - but the low temperature didn't deter this hardy group.

Welcome back to Ipswich Belinda - a Goodgym Worthing regular, who had visited us previously and joined us again tonight.

We needed something to warm up prior to getting stuck into the task so we set off for a run that would bring us back to pick up the litter pick kit. It was a gentle start before arriving at the bottom of Devonshire Road - possibly the steepest hill in Ipswich. There was a choice of 1 or 2 ascents focussing on good arm drive technique before moving on and luckily finding a down hill towards the college!

We then had 40-50m section picking up speed all the way through. Unfortunately we picked up a casualty when Nick was shot in the hamstring by sniper - leading to an ice pack and an early end to the session for him - hope you're feeling better when you read this Nick.

Returning to our starting point, litter pick and bags were issued and we scoured a mainly floodlit section of the Waterfront along river on behalf of Rivercare. This is a task we do intermittently covering a large area aiming to prevent rubbish and particularly plastic finding it's way into the river.

With the task done it was time for a "fun" circuit session with two groups working in tandem - 1 group running varying intervals around a short course, while the other endured some core strength and balance circuits - keeping everyone moving to avoid getting cold.

Super work from everyone on a non-stop super circuit!
